Orange- Laurenda “Lee” “Leeline” (Duguay) Holmes, 90, of Orange, Ma, passed away Tuesday, January 24, 2023 at Alliance Health at Baldwinville.
Born in Athol on January 12, 1933, she was the daughter of the late Hyacinthe and Anna (Savoie) Duguay. She grew up in Athol and graduated from Athol High School.
She was previously married to Lyman Holmes for 32 years.
Laurenda previously worked at the L.S. Starrett Co. and at several restaurants as a prep cook.
She loved to play poker. She enjoyed game shows and dancing. She loved to watch the Patriots, especially Tom Brady.
She was a tomboy growing up and played baseball in school. She was also a good ice skater.
Survivors include a son Michael Holmes of Sanbornville, N.H., a daughter Chris-Ann Holmes of Athol, grandchildren, Brittney Holmes, Kaylyn McCorquodale, Jillian Euvrard, Joseph Holmes and Lauren Langan. Great grand children, Keira, Jay and Josephine; sisters, Marie Songer and Jeannette Capone; and many nieces and nephews.
Besides her parents she was predeceased by a son, Daryl Holmes and brothers Wilbert(Shrimpy) Leonard(Pee Wee) Edward (Smokey) Johnny, Nelson(Nussie) and Richard. Sisters, Laura and Marguerite Duguay and Edna Mallett.
There are no calling hours or services.
Interment in Silver Lake Cemetery, Athol, will be private.
